The A40MX02-1PL68I is a high-performance Field Programmable Gate Array (FPGA) from Microchip Technology's MX Series, engineered for demanding applications in aerospace, automotive, industrial, medical, and telecommunications sectors. This programmable logic IC delivers reliable performance with 3000 gates and 57 I/O pins in a compact 68-PLCC surface mount package.
Key Features:
- 3000 gates for flexible logic implementation
- 57 I/O pins for versatile connectivity
- Wide operating voltage range: 3V ~ 3.6V, 4.5V ~ 5.5V
- Industrial temperature range: -40°C ~ 85°C (TA)
- Surface mount 68-LCC (J-Lead) package
